The Cots 4 Tots story began in the year 2010 with a fundraising appeal to Bristol's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U) at St Michael's Hospital. Since its inception, the charity has raised tens and thousands of pounds to assist families with sick or premature babies in the West of England and South Wales. Its mission includes family accommodation homes and the provision of state-of-the-art equipment for the NICU.

Cots for Tots House serves as a "home away from home" for families being treated in a hospital. It is located near the NICU and allows parents to be close to their children. The charity has helped more than 2,100 families stay in the house since 2012.

Families staying at Cots For Tots House are reassured they are not on their own. They have a community of other parents who are experiencing the same thing as them, and they can help each other out. In addition they have access to many services to make their stay as comfortable as possible.

The Cots 4 Tots website

The Cots 4 Tots website is the home of a unique charity that is raising funds for the Neonatal Intensive Care Unit at St Michael's Hospital in Bristol. The charity is a part of Wallace & Gromit's Grand Appeal, and it also supports Cots for Tots House which offers free home-from-home accommodation to families whose children are treated in the neonatal intensive-care unit. The charity has assisted thousands over the past decade.

Abbey Silvester's two children Alfie and Mollie spent time at St Michael's Hospital's neonatal intensive unit. She says Cots for Tots was "an absolute Godsend" and her family and she would not have been capable of coping without it. "You make friends here, and you build a real community and feel a deep love for each other," she said. "Without it who knows what our lives would have been like."
